Over Work examines the pervasive culture of overwork in Canada and its detrimental effects on workers, families, and society. It highlights the lack of work-life balance, especially for women and caregivers, and how current economic models fail to value unpaid labour. Schulte showcases potential solutions such as shorter workweeks, fair labour practices, and a re-evaluation of societal values to prioritise worker well-being over mere economic output. It criticises the prevailing "fiduciary absolutism," which prioritises shareholders over worker welfare and emphasises the need for systemic changes—including government policies and corporate practices—to address work-related stress and burnout. The tbook explores examples from other countries, such as Japan's karoshi culture and Iceland's short work hours experiment, to illustrate alternative approaches to work. Ultimately, it calls for a shift towards "responsible capitalism" that values human capital and promotes shared prosperity.
